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 36, The Crescent, Stafford is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£198,297 and a rental value of £1,049 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£175,635 and a rental value of £929 per month.

Energy Efficiency
36, The Crescent, Stafford has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 18 Mar 2015.
The property is connected to mains gas and has mostly double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 36, The Crescent, Stafford was last sold on 5th June 2018 for £158,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since June 2018, the market for similar properties has risen by 27.8%.
